The group planning tag on WindowsForum covers discussions about coordinating activities and events within groups, particularly through Microsoft's GroupMe app. Recent content highlights the integration of Microsoft's AI-powered Copilot into GroupMe, which enhances collaborative planning for campus users. The feature aims to streamline scheduling, task management, and communication among group members, reflecting a broader trend of AI redefining casual and collaborative chat experiences. While the tag focuses on group planning tools and strategies, it also touches on the evolution of messaging ecosystems and the role of artificial intelligence in improving group coordination. Users exploring this tag will find insights into how AI can simplify group logistics and foster more efficient teamwork.
